Qualifying Requirements:
Your City of Pittsburgh application will be reviewed and your work experience and education/training will be evaluated to determine if you meet the qualifying eligibility requirements listed below for this position. You will be sent an eligibility letter regarding your eligible/ineligible status.
WORK EXPERIENCE: Applicants must clearly meet or exceed one of the following requirements listed below to qualify for this position. (Less than full-time experience will be calculated on a pro-rated basis.)
EDUCATION/TRAINING: The application must clearly show a high-school diploma or GED equivalency; vocational education/training preferred.
EQUIVALENCY: Education/training may be substituted for work experience on a year for year basis if the application clearly shows the required number of years to meet the Total Qualifying Requirement for this position (based on the sum of work experience and education/training listed above). The total qualifying requirement is five (5) years. Candidates who did not go through an apprenticeship program to obtain a Journeyman Certificate MUST show five (5) years of Construction Supervision experience. Eligible applicants must possess one of the following combinations of education and work experience:
Painter Journeyman License one (1) year experience supervising others (5 Total Qualifying Years);
-OR-
Four (4) years Painting work one (1) year experience supervising others (5 Total Qualifying Years);
-OR-
Five (5) years supervision work in the construction industry (5 Total Qualifying Years).
